Save data in pdf phpword

Phpoffice\phpword\templateprocessorsaveas php code. I basically start with a template and populate the fields and save it as a word report. The following is a basic example of the phpword library. Generate a word document using phpword in laravel help us to produce details into word documents. Phpword is a part of the phpoffice library which enables to read and write documents in different file formats from php.

This tutorial shows how to add bar, line, column and other chart types in phpword. Hit the convert button, and then download your pdf. Jun, 2019 the phpword is a library written in pure php that provides a set of classes to write to and read from different document file formats. Aug 12, 2016 if you are looking to learn how to export or convert html text or html file to microsoft word document. Iofactory, phpoffice\ phpword php code examples hotexamples. For reading word file with php i would suggest following library phpofficephpword if you are not concerned about formatting you can simply read files in php re. Dec 09, 2019 a pure php library for reading and writing word processing documents phpofficephpword. Mar 03, 20 save mysql data as pdf with php heres the files required to save the table to pdf. Php phpoffice\ phpword \templateprocessorsaveas 11 examples found. Mar 02, 2017 here is the code to read docx file in php but it cant read. By default, phpword uses zip extension to deal with zip compressed archives and files inside them.

Currently, im trying to convert my php to word and been googling for a long time about this. If you cant have zip extension installed on your server, you can use pure php library alternative, pclzip, which is included in phpword. To create your word file from this object you need to save it using the word2007 writer. Supported formats are html, odtext, pdf, rtf and word2007. If i use the following code to generate a pdf from a word document i end up with a pdf with formatting whihc does not match the original doc in any way. Phpword a pure php library for reading and writing word processing documents ooxml, odf, rtf, html, pdf 0. How to edit microsoft documents in database using php quora. Fortunately there is a free pdf viewing program that allows you fill out fillable forms and save the changes, to be edited later if need be. Supported formats are html, odtext, pdf, rtf and word2007, which we will concentrate on. Laravel create word document file using phpofficephpword. Here we are introducing how to read a word file using phpword and convert it to pdf file using tcpdf.

For your information, im using suse linux as my server. Three ways to create word documents with phpword mayflower blog. Phpword uses zip extension to deal with zip compressed archives and files. To not rely on the file extension and guarantee that the file contents is really pdf adobe portable format, you may specify pdfsaveoptions as 2nd parameter. Save data from pdf file to a word doc learn qtp uft. These are the top rated real world php examples of phpoffice\ phpword \iofactory extracted from open source projects. Three ways to create a word document using phpword helpdev. Now i need to resave the templated docx as a pdf file. The easiest way to create, edit, convert and sign pdf documents on windows and mac. Convert excel or docs file to pdf vasundhara vision. These are the top rated real world php examples of phpoffice\ phpword \templateprocessorsaveas extracted from open source projects.

By default, it is saving files with ansi encoding for me. By default, phpword uses zip extension to deal with zip compressed archives and files inside. For example if you have some important data like terms and conditions then its always want to pdf or word that way we can get in better formate, so in laravel 5 you can do it using phpofficephpword composer package. It sounds like save isnt returning what you expect it to, and im not seeing where its documented otherwise. Conversion of microsoft word file to pdf using phpword and tcpdf. In this controller, we have two methods index to show news table and download to generate msword files from news table. Phpoffice\phpword\templateprocessorsaveas php code examples.

Phpword is open source and currently available in version 0. Jan 31, 2014 export phphtml table to pdf, csv, png, xml, json, sql, txt, ms excel and ms word english duration. When i save the original file as a word97 filethe styling is even worse. In libreoffice, there is a form template, which can be used in design mode to fill in text fields, which you can then read back with phpword.

Generate ms word document files with codeigniter and. If you want to achieve the best results, easiest thing to do is. However, when i save the pdf file, the formatting is all lost. Three ways to create word documents with phpword mayflower. Now youll have a saved pdf with all the text you entered. Take an html file and convert it quickly into excel, pdf or word format with php. Hi i am using tcpdf within phpword and i would really appreciate some help. Php phpoffice\phpword iofactoryload 19 examples found. These are the top rated real world php examples of phpoffice\ phpword \iofactoryload extracted from open source projects. This stepbystep tutorial will walk you through how to convert html to docx in php. Jul 21, 2017 in todays world, we sometimes require to create word document for export some data. These are the top rated real world php examples of phpoffice\phpword\iofactory extracted from open source projects.

This is a proof of concept for generating text documents open document odt, word docx and portable document format pdf files from html and table data using the phpword library. These are the top rated real world php examples of phpoffice\phpword\templateprocessorsaveas extracted from open source projects. I propose a simpler answer is to locate the file phpword. Attached youll find the url removed, login to view and the small script to do this. Phpword is a library written in pure php that provides a set of classes to write to and read from. Php phpoffice\ phpword \templateprocessor 12 examples found. In todays world, we sometimes require to create word document for export some data. The current version of phpword supports microsoft office open xml ooxml or openxml, oasis open document format for office applications opendocument or odf, rich text format rtf, html, and pdf. Then i save it to a temp file load it by the iofactory and then save it as a pdf i have the same issue by converting into a word2007 format.

Then, you can save it in your dropbox and print it out when you get to another. Generate a word document using phpword in laravel learn. Edit the html and table data below and press one of the document type button at the bottom to create a document. By microsoft documents, i am assuming you mean documents created with microsoft word.

These are the top rated real world php examples of phpoffice\phpword\iofactoryload extracted from open source projects. There is an option to integrate dompdf with php word to convert file to pdf after editing template, but it wont give expected result of a wellformated document. Iofactory, phpoffice\phpword php code examples hotexamples. Generate ms word document files with codeigniter and phpword. Alternatively provide me a solution that will generate pdf files from given docx files. Php script for convert or export html text to ms word file. But your code already defines the path used by pdfword, so just save that same path. Phpoffice\phpword\templateprocessor php code examples. Import phpword original file from third party folder. You can rate examples to help us improve the quality of examples. Phpword is an open source project licensed under the terms of lgpl version 3. Nov 29, 2016 how to add chart to docx with phpword.

After you install pdf xchange viewer, open your fillable pdf form rightclick and choose open with if pdf xchange viewer isnt the default for opening pdfs. Laravel 5 create word document file using phpoffice. Copying changed license has been split into two files as recommended here h. It works fine but now i want to convert the generated file to pdf first i tried using tcpdf in combination with phpword. The file format will be detected automatically from the file extension. Resolve problem with phpword and pdf pdf php software.

Iofactoryload, phpoffice\phpword php code examples. For example if you have some important data like terms and conditions then its always want to pdf or word that way we can get in better formate, so in laravel 5 you can do it using phpoffice phpword composer package. Unzip it and read the output as an xml text with tags file. With phpword you can create beautiful word and pdf documents from scratch. Php phpoffice\ phpword iofactoryload 19 examples found.

Phpword, phpoffice\phpword php code examples hotexamples. Phpword is a library written in pure php that provides a set of classes to write to and read from different document file formats. These are the top rated real world php examples of phpoffice\phpword\phpword extracted from open source projects. A pure php library for reading and writing word processing documents phpofficephpword. Save mysql data as pdf with php heres the files required to save the table to pdf. Express yourself both verbally and visually with a full. Php phpoffice\phpword\templateprocessorsaveas 11 examples found. Here is the code to read docx file in php but it cant read.

If you are looking to learn how to export or convert html text or html file to microsoft word document. Now i need to re save the templated docx as a pdf file. How to convert word document into pdf using phpword stack. I propose a simpler answer is to locate the file i. These are the top rated real world php examples of phpoffice\ phpword \templateprocessor extracted from open source projects.

I would like to convert this report into a pdf file. Export phphtml table to pdf, csv, png, xml, json, sql, txt, ms excel and ms word english duration. Your task is to modify the lib or the settings og phpword so the generated pdf looks like the original word document. Opendocument or odf, rich text format rtf, html, and pdf. How to edit word document templates with php and convert. The phpword is a library written in pure php that provides a set of classes to write to and read from different document file formats. Not every feature of microsoft word is implemented in phpword.

Phpword is part of the phpoffice library, which makes it possible to read and write documents in various file formats completely in php. Laravel create word document file using phpofficephpword package. Conversion of microsoft word file to pdf using phpword and. In order to create word files with php, as previously mentioned, we are. How to create a word file with php in symfony 3 our code world. I have added the following lines at the end of the samples php code. I am creating a microsoft word report using phpword. Php phpoffice\ phpword iofactory 30 examples found. Modify existing document template processor vs phpword.

542 1555 307 8 970 616 1347 1573 1205 525 809 773 728 452 685 466 1287 179 52 295 420 806 727 322 1105 837 329 31 726 1128 1293 655